Default Brabus Illuminated Door Sills

Hey guys,

I'm having some door sills custom made so i am thinking about selling my Brabus ones.

When Brabus sell them they basically just send you the metal trims so the standard AMG's have been modified to accept the illumination strip, if any of you have seen pictures of B55's car then they are 100% identical to them.

I will also include the inverters and wiring instructions, its a very easy install you do need to snip 2 of the factory wires to follow the Brabus install method but wire taps can also be used without issue you will have instructions for both.
